Consumer behaviour in food and drink is shifting fast. Health optimisation, new functional expectations, changing flavour cues and cultural influence are reshaping what consumers want, and how categories will grow.


This free report brings together five macro trends that will materially impact food and drink categories in 2026 and 2027, outlining how senior teams anticipate change and make more confident category decisions.


Using large-scale social intelligence, the analysis highlights 200M+ consumer conversations across platforms including TikTok, Instagram and X to identify early signals of changing behaviour.
